puppetlabs / puppet-specifications

Specification of the Puppet Language, Catalog, Extension points
Other
99 stars 66 forks source link

(PE-12458) File path changes for PE client tools #58

Closed jdwelch closed 8 years ago

jdwelch commented 8 years ago

Update to the file_path.md file to capture recent additions for PE client tools

MosesMendoza commented 8 years ago

+1

jdwelch commented 8 years ago

Can one of @shrug @MosesMendoza merge this if you're happy with it?

shrug commented 8 years ago

ping @joshcooper @kylog Do y'all have any input here? I'll merge otherwise

kylog commented 8 years ago

:+1:

joshcooper commented 8 years ago

LGTM. One side note, the directory C:\ProgramData\PuppetLabs\client-tools is writable by all users, and the MSI should restrict permissions on that directory as it will presumably contain passwords, etc, e.g. https://github.com/puppetlabs/puppet_for_the_win/blob/master/wix/puppet.wxs#L296-L301. It's not hard to do, but we need to make sure that happens. /cc @Iristyle